Output 89c5c58a2609a8f16f1f5c13a67d0f8ee0b4e73f0bd18b9202d88b5798d7f2bc:2

value
395965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e36fb5989008b7deb4568a40bbb8c41792a81603 OP_EQUAL
address
3NRb8nsDVpp1VqqHkZsoPw4cFCPFtWmtt8
transaction
89c5c58a2609a8f16f1f5c13a67d0f8ee0b4e73f0bd18b9202d88b5798d7f2bc
confirmations
155881
spent
true